About a half-hour north of the New River Gorge is the Gauley River drainage. The main northern shore of Lake Summersville is home to a host of high-quality single-pitch sport routes. Ratings range from 5.easy (slabs left of Orange Oswald) to 5.15 (in the Coliseum). There are plenty of as-of-yet unsent projects, and lots of new development potential, too. Water levels in the lake vary seasonally, which in turn affects the accessibility of certain routes. During warm months, the reservoir can be a great relief from the oppressive summer heat. During colder seasons, the drained lakebed opens up as a treeless landscape that soaks up all the sunlight, making it a great cold-weather destination.
Beyond the main north shore Summersville climbing, Whippoorwill has great swimming and DWS in the summer and amazing roped moderates in the winter. Long Point is another great early spring/late fall destination, with relatively few crowds. Farther downstream, below the dam that forms the lake, you'll find adventure crags along the Gauley River like Carnifex Ferry and some excellent bouldering.

Whippoorwill, Long Point, and parts of Summersville Lake are accessible when the reading for Summersville Lake at the link above is below 1600ft. When they drain the lake is dependent on many different factors and it's hard to say when it will be down/up with any sort of certainty.
Please note that there have been a few break-ins in these areas. Make sure to park as close to the road as possible and keep valuables out of sight. It can be a bad idea to park behind the big hill at the parking lot!
